在 TypeScript 中使用 axios 需要进行一些配置和类型声明。下面是使用 axios 的一般步骤:
1. 安装 axios:
在项目中使用 npm 或 yarn 安装 axios:
```bash
npm install axios
```
2. 导入 axios:
在需要使用 axios 的文件中,导入 axios 模块:
```typescript
import axios from 'axios';
```
3. 发送请求:
使用 axios 发送 HTTP 请求,可以使用 `axios.get()`、`axios.post()` 等方法发送不同类型的请求:
```typescript
axios.get(url)
.then(response => {
// 请求成功后的处理
})
.catch(error => {
// 请求失败后的处理
});
```
4. 配置请求参数:
可以通过第二个参数传递请求参数、请求头等配置项:
```typescript
axios.get(url, {
params: {
key1: value1,
key2: v